A view from the hills of SkafidiaSkafidia is a small village 12 kilometres far from Pyrgos, build at the slope of a hill and near the sea (at a distance of 1 kilometre). A second village grew the last years next to Skafidia, the Panorama made up of summer houses. Skafidia owes its name to the monastery of 'Panagia Skafidiotissa', which is build at the foothill, under the village. This monastery is quite old with great walls and embrasures, build around it, to defend against pirates.
At a small distance, west of the monastery, are the camping installations of Skafidia,Camp Installations at Skafidia at the edge of a small, beautiful holly forest. The camp was used by the state, but since late 70's returned to the church of Ilia. Today it is used as the main camp site of Pyrgos' and other regions' Scouts and is used also by the church to host guests from various countries.
